Разбивка диска и свободное место.
Модератор: Bizdelnick
-
- Сообщения: 1
- ОС: Debian
Разбивка диска и свободное место.
Помогите, не могу установить софт по причине(Если я верно понял):
Недостаточно места на диске ( Конкретно мал /tmp и / ).
Правильно, ли разбит диск? И как его почистить? Или правильно разбить.
Систему ставил не сам.
df -h
Filesystem Size Used Avail Use% Mounted on
/dev/sda1 259M 226M 20M 93% /
tmpfs 251M 0 251M 0% /lib/init/rw
udev 247M 100K 247M 1% /dev
tmpfs 251M 0 251M 0% /dev/shm
/dev/sda5 1.9G 65M 1.7G 4% /home
/dev/sda6 1.9G 396M 1.4G 23% /usr
/dev/sda7 68G 408M 65G 1% /var
overflow 1.0M 1.0M 0 100% /tmp
P.S.Реально же не могу справиться с обрезанием ICQ и прочей фигни для офисного сообщества.
Недостаточно места на диске ( Конкретно мал /tmp и / ).
Правильно, ли разбит диск? И как его почистить? Или правильно разбить.
Систему ставил не сам.
df -h
Filesystem Size Used Avail Use% Mounted on
/dev/sda1 259M 226M 20M 93% /
tmpfs 251M 0 251M 0% /lib/init/rw
udev 247M 100K 247M 1% /dev
tmpfs 251M 0 251M 0% /dev/shm
/dev/sda5 1.9G 65M 1.7G 4% /home
/dev/sda6 1.9G 396M 1.4G 23% /usr
/dev/sda7 68G 408M 65G 1% /var
overflow 1.0M 1.0M 0 100% /tmp
P.S.Реально же не могу справиться с обрезанием ICQ и прочей фигни для офисного сообщества.
-
- Сообщения: 8735
- Статус: GPG ID: 4DFBD1D6 дом горит, козёл не видит...
- ОС: Slackware-current
Re: Разбивка диска и свободное место.
конечно мало. надо метров 500 минимум.
тоже мало. я правда не знаю, зачем эта система, но по любому 1.9 мало
дык а это что? вообще пусто что-ли?
грузитесь с LiveCD, и переразмечайте. отрезайте от var.
ЗЫЖ и где вы такую разбивку-то нашли? в мануале 1990го года?
-
- Модератор
- Сообщения: 4823
- Статус: фанат консоли (=
- ОС: GNU/Debian, RHEL
Re: Разбивка диска и свободное место.
Наоборот - забито.
да и вообще, судя по разбивке, больше на сервак похоже.
А вообще, нужно либо переразбивать через live cd (например gparted), либо, если уж очень лениво и никаких ценных данных нет (если они есть - обязательно скопировать) просто переустановить систему с новой разбивкой. При вашей разбивке, второй вариант - проще.
UNIX is basically a simple operating system, but you have to be a genius to understand the simplicity. © Dennis Ritchie
The more you believe you don't do mistakes, the more bugs are in your code.
The more you believe you don't do mistakes, the more bugs are in your code.
-
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: Разбивка диска и свободное место.
Предварительно забекапив все ценные файлы. О подобных мелочах часто забывают.
А вообще в /var и /usr места хватает, а пакетный менеджер как правило только эти директории использует, так-что не вполне понятно от чего софт не ставится.
P.S. а чего там с ICQ и зачем его обрезать (он и так из Израиля родом, значит обрезанный из коробки)?
-
- Сообщения: 8735
- Статус: GPG ID: 4DFBD1D6 дом горит, козёл не видит...
- ОС: Slackware-current
Re: Разбивка диска и свободное место.
а мне - понятно:
дык там жалкий метр всего.
можно сказать - пусто.
-
- Сообщения: 3340
- Статус: It's the GNU Age
- ОС: Debian
Re: Разбивка диска и свободное место.
Вы шутите так, или правда не въезжаете? По-вашему если ёмкость для чего-либо (к примеру кружка) заполнена до краёв, но при этом очень маленькая сама по себе - то можно сказать она пустая?
-
- Сообщения: 8735
- Статус: GPG ID: 4DFBD1D6 дом горит, козёл не видит...
- ОС: Slackware-current
Re: Разбивка диска и свободное место.
стакан с водкой, где по стенкам размазана 1 капля водки, с практической т.з. пуст.
так и HDD с tmp равным 1Мб === HDD без tmp.
А вопрос о наполнении такого малого /tmp эквивалентен вопросу деления на ноль. А при делении на ноль, как известно, получается неопределённость. (:
дык понимайте буквально -
Q: сколько мб в tmp?
A: 1.
Стало быть, tmp - пуст. Ибо 1Mb в tmp === почти пусто. С т.з. программ и системы. Т.з. таблицы разделов меня волнует мало...
-
- Сообщения: 2284
- Статус: Толчковый инженер
- ОС: Debian, Fedora
Re: Разбивка диска и свободное место.
временный костыль - /tmp сделать симлинком куда-нибудь на /var/tmp, раз уж там места дофига. Так, в принципе, можно жить некоторое время.
Losing is fun!
-
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: Разбивка диска и свободное место.
На сколько я понимаю /tmp в данном случае находится не на харде а в RAM, так-что его расширение не должно составить проблем.
arkhnchul
Думаю mount --bind /var/tmp /tmp будет более… аккуратно что-ли.
Или вообще mount -t tmpfs -o size=128M tmpfs /tmp
arkhnchul
Думаю mount --bind /var/tmp /tmp будет более… аккуратно что-ли.
Или вообще mount -t tmpfs -o size=128M tmpfs /tmp
-
- Сообщения: 9
Re: Разбивка диска и свободное место.
я просто монтирую к корневой /, зачем огород городить
разбивают программы.гепардет, акронис и много других
-
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: Разбивка диска и свободное место.
Держать /tmp в памяти или хотя-бы на отдельном разделе практичнее. В первом случае временные файлы читаются/пишутся быстрее и не нагружают диск лишниней нагрузкой. Если просто на отдельный раздел выносить то не будет фрагментироваться раздел с системными файлами, а если на отдельные разделы вынести ещё /var и /home то можно будет корневой раздел примонтировать только на чтение что в общем-то кошерно для статичных систем.
-
- Сообщения: 8735
- Статус: GPG ID: 4DFBD1D6 дом горит, козёл не видит...
- ОС: Slackware-current
Re: Разбивка диска и свободное место.
а это НЕ правда. Вы забыли про кеширование. У нас не венда.
т.е. на отдельном разделе /tmp/ нужно держать. Но не в памяти. на отдельном разделе по соображениям безопасности, ибо это общедоступный раздел. А вот в памяти не обязательно (хотя можно, из-за той-же безопасности)
если вы всё же пожелаете держать /tmp/ на диске, то нужно продумать меры его очистки при выходе из системы.
-
- Бывший модератор
- Сообщения: 4038
- Статус: Искусственный интеллект (pre-alpha)
- ОС: Debian GNU/Linux
Re: Разбивка диска и свободное место.
Кеширование все равно подразумевает необходимость обращения к диску. Для временных файлов, думаю, соотношение числа чтений/записи несколько хуже (с т.з. кеша) по сравнению со среднестатистическим не временным файлом, а значит кеш для /tmp менее полезен. В то же время, tmpfs может засвопиться в случае неиспользования, но не требует обязательного обращения к диску.
Мои розовые очки
-
- Сообщения: 8735
- Статус: GPG ID: 4DFBD1D6 дом горит, козёл не видит...
- ОС: Slackware-current
Re: Разбивка диска и свободное место.
watashiwa_darede... писал(а): ↑06.09.2011 13:39Кеширование все равно подразумевает необходимость обращения к диску. Для временных файлов, думаю, соотношение числа чтений/записи несколько хуже (с т.з. кеша) по сравнению со среднестатистическим не временным файлом, а значит кеш для /tmp менее полезен. В то же время, tmpfs может засвопиться в случае неиспользования, но не требует обязательного обращения к диску.
ну давайте померим.
на моих системах нет разницы. я проверял компиляцию ядра, и прочие ресурсоёмкие задачи.
и да. Уважаемый watashiwa_darede..., вы забыли про отложенную запись. При всём уважении, не мне вам упоминать об этом. Особенно в этой теме.
-
- Бывший модератор
- Сообщения: 4038
- Статус: Искусственный интеллект (pre-alpha)
- ОС: Debian GNU/Linux
Re: Разбивка диска и свободное место.
А что, при компиляции создаются временные файлы? ЕМНИП, gcc -pipe существует давно и широко используется. Лично я вообще не могу припомнить у себя задач, которые интенсивно используют /tmp: у меня там в основном сокеты всяких X Window, ssh-agent'ов, emacs'а и пр. и пара времянок от fvwm (конфиги обрабатываются m4).
Мои розовые очки
-
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: Разбивка диска и свободное место.
watashiwa_daredeska писал(а): ↑06.09.2011 13:39Кеширование все равно подразумевает необходимость обращения к диску. Для временных файлов, думаю, соотношение числа чтений/записи несколько хуже (с т.з. кеша) по сравнению со среднестатистическим не временным файлом, а значит кеш для /tmp менее полезен. В то же время, tmpfs может засвопиться в случае неиспользования, но не требует обязательного обращения к диску.
Вот примерно это я и собирался ответить. Зачем вообще писать что-то на диск если это можно не писать, а потом ещё и думать как это с диска убирать в случае перезагрузки. Подсистема управления памятью, в данном случае, справится с задачей эффективнее чем планировщик ввода вывода.